SSike, an Electric Scooter Doing 40 km with 5 Cents

Enter the SSike, another Spanish EV design destined for cross-town commuting, sporting a neat, funny look and top-drawer performance specs, offered at a very affordable price. Riding the SSike daily to work or school will most likely save you money for another one in the first year or so.

The SSike is infintely more fun than being stranded in a traffic jam for hours each day. It will allow people to get from A to B way faster because it can go anywhere a traditional scooter can: alleys and sidewalks, parks, metro and all.

You get a 20 km/h (12.4 mph) max speed and 120 minutes of use, making the range of the SSike comparable to a lot of similar electric vehicles. However, the folding design adn 12 kg (26 lbs) weight make it easy to carry it up the stairs.. and you can't to this with a casual electric scooter.

SSike moves by means of a 250W brushless motor and a 40V 6Ah LiFePO4 battery offering more than 2000 cycles. Zero maintenance and ultra-bright LED lighting make the SSike even more convenient, while the rear-wheel steering grants unbelievable maneuverability to the user, making it suitable for crowded places, too.

Regenerative brakes and anodized aluminium body work (carbon fiber is optional) are making the SSike well worth the €1,390 ($1,830) + VAT price tag, considering what you pay on electricity to charge it. And no parking fees!
